Transaction 90645644cf222d2ed4b94f9bf549b121c1314147944a77c390f39fe2ecb580fa

1 Input
2 Outputs
  • 90645644cf222d2ed4b94f9bf549b121c1314147944a77c390f39fe2ecb580fa:0
  • value  14978554
    address  1CcvUXE2BaLmcJi8wtUAGH7r17dqLqnpKA
  • 90645644cf222d2ed4b94f9bf549b121c1314147944a77c390f39fe2ecb580fa:1
  • value  2420091674
    address  1P9RQEr2XeE3PEb44ZE35sfZRRW1JHU8qx